Is almond butter good for stomach? Studies suggest that almonds feed good bacteria living in your gut, serving as prebiotics. “So, what’s that?” you may ask. Prebiotics are types of dietary fiber that feed your gut with healthy bacteria. In turn, all that healthy bacteria produces nutrients that ensure you have a healthy digestive system.

Is almond butter OK for IBS?
Almond butter is also an acceptable low- FODMAP food, if you stick to one tablespoon per meal or snack. Almond milk is also a go-to with the low-FODMAP diet and a great beverage option while avoiding lactose.
Can I eat too much almond butter?
Almonds (and almond butter) are also high in oxalates. If you have a history of kidney stones, or you’re at risk of developing them, you should avoid almond butter or limit how much you eat.

Why do nuts make me bloated?
The high fat and fibre content in nuts means that it takes a while for them to be properly digested. As they spend a lot of time working through the digestive system, the risk for gas and bloating is markedly increased. Nuts also contain tannins which can present problems like nausea for some.

Does apple cider vinegar help bloating?
There’s no scientific evidence to suggest that ACV is an effective treatment for bloating or gas. In fact, the only clinical study ever completed on ACV and digestive problems found that ACV can actually impair gastric emptying.

Are nut butters easier to digest than nuts?
2 Easier to Digest
Because many raw nut butters are soaked and sprouted before processing, they’re much easier to digest too. All raw foods enhance enzyme production in the body that helps digest our food, while cooked food actually depletes these enzymes.
